Regulation of Genome Editing in Plant Biotechnology: Canada,adapted for genetically modified (GM) crops in the early 1990s and has proven sufficiently robust in responding to these new plant breeding techniques, having approved two varieties of gene edited canola. Regulation of Genome Editing in Plant Biotechnology: Japan,f Biological Diversity through Regulations on the Use of Living Modified Organisms 2003. This law can be regarded as a product-based GMO regulation.
